   >    On Thu, 11 Jul 2013 12:55:34 +0000 (GMT) Artem Popov
   >    said:
   >    color2 is the DIMMEST it can be... this is ambient light. ie "black" or
   "no
   >    light from light source". if it is 250 as in your example.. u wont even
   see
   >    it
   >    get dark. you see a bright rect all the time - just SLIGHTLY getting
   darker
   >    (255 -> 250 and back). set color2 to be 0 0 0 and u'll see it shade.
   >    you ALSO have another problem.. your light source is VERY close to the
   > rect. light brightness is calculated at the vertices PER vertex. this is
   the
   > case because it is gouraud shaded. that means that color is interplated
   > between the
   >    vertexes. if your light is in the middle of the rect but VERY close to
   it
   >    (and
   >    it is - just 10 pixels away) then the verticies will be at steep angles
   to
   >    the
   >    light point and thus dark UNTIL it rotates, then the edges that are not
   >    roated
   >    are lighter as they rotate to face the light and those far in the
   distance
   >    point further away and thus get dark. try zplane for the pointofview
   (light
   >    too) as -500 or -1000 and see. :)

   >    >    On Tue, 09 Jul 2013 14:51:40 +0000 (GMT) Artem Popov
   >    >    said:
   >    >    you set both color and color2... color is the light color, color2
   is
   >    the
   >    >    ambient   light...   color2...   should  be  always  dimmer  than
   >    color...  you're
   >    >    setting up the impossible... ie ambient light is brighter than the
   >    >    lightsource. :)
